What is an Osisoft Pi Remote job?

An Osisoft PI Remote job involves managing, configuring, and maintaining the OSIsoft PI System, a data historian software used for real-time data collection and analysis. This role is performed remotely and typically includes tasks such as system integration, troubleshooting, data visualization, and support for industrial applications. Professionals in this role work with industries like manufacturing, energy, and utilities to ensure efficient data monitoring and decision-making. Strong expertise in PI System tools, interfaces, and remote collaboration is essential for success in this position.

What are some typical responsibilities of a remote OSIsoft PI specialist?

Remote OSIsoft PI specialists are usually responsible for configuring and maintaining PI System data infrastructure, troubleshooting issues, and supporting integration with other data sources or business systems. Day-to-day tasks often include developing data visualizations, optimizing system performance, and providing technical support to end-users across various sites. They often collaborate with on-site engineers, IT, and operations teams via virtual meetings and communication platforms. This role requires strong analytical skills and the ability to manage multiple projects remotely while ensuring data integrity and operational reliability.

Job description

Overview
We are seeking a Cyber Security SME with deep expertise in Operational Technology (OT) security for water and wastewater utilities. This role will lead cybersecurity strategy, architecture, and risk management for industrial control systems (ICS), SCADA networks, and process automation systems critical to water infrastructure. The SME will ensure compliance with federal standards, improve resilience against cyber threats, and support EPA and utility partners in safeguarding public health and environmental resources
Responsibilities
  • OT Cybersecurity Strategy
  • Develop and implement security architectures for water utility OT environments (SCADA, PLCs, RTUs, HMIs).
  • Design segmentation strategies (Purdue Model, DMZ, secure remote access).
  • Integrate OT telemetry into enterprise SOC/SIEM for threat detection.
  • Risk Assessment & Compliance
  • Conduct OT risk assessments for water/wastewater systems.
  • Align with NIST SP 800-82, ISA/IEC 62443, and EPA cybersecurity guidance.
  • Prepare and maintain System Security Plans (SSPs), POA&Ms, and RMF documentation.
  • Incident Response & Resilience
  • Develop OT-specific incident response playbooks and tabletop exercises.
  • Support forensic analysis and recovery planning for cyber-physical systems.
  • Stakeholder Engagement
  • Collaborate with water utility operators, engineers, and EPA program leads.
  • Deliver executive briefings and technical reports on OT cyber posture
  • Must have the ability to communicate accurate information

Qualifications
Required:
  • 10+ years in cybersecurity;
  • 8+ years in OT/ICS security for water utilities or critical infrastructure.
  • Hands-on experience with:SCADA platforms (e.g., Wonderware, Ignition, OSIsoft PI).OT protocols (Modbus, DNP3, OPC-UA).Passive monitoring tools (Nozomi, Claroty, Dragos).
  • Strong knowledge of NIST SP 800-82, ISA/IEC 62443, and RMF.
  • U.S. Citizenship; Public Trust eligibility.

Desired:
  • Bachelor's in Cybersecurity, Engineering, or related field.
  • Certifications: GICSP, CISSP, GRID, ISA/IEC 62443.
  • Experience with EPA programs, water/wastewater operations, or municipal utilities.
